Compare Springdale to Bentonville

This post compares Springdale, Arkansas to Bentonville, Arkansas across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.

Dimension Springdale (city) Bentonville (city)
Population 77,252 44,601
Income (median) $32,239 $56,446
Home Value (median) $142,700 $203,800
White 62% 80%
Black 2% 2%
Asian 2% 10%
With Kids 44% 43%
Age (median) 31 32
Rentals 50% 45%
